What are some common challenges faced in an Evening Merchandise Display role and how can they be managed?

One common challenge in an Evening Merchandise Display role is working efficiently within tight timeframes, as displays often need to be refreshed after store hours without disrupting closing procedures. Additionally, team members must coordinate closely to ensure that merchandising standards are met while maintaining safety and organization in a quieter, low-staff environment. Strong communication skills and adaptability are key, as priorities may shift based on inventory arrivals or promotional changes. Staying organized and proactive in anticipating needs can help manage these challenges effectively.

What are evening merchandise display jobs?

Evening merchandise display jobs involve arranging and organizing products on shelves and displays in retail stores during evening hours. Workers in these roles ensure that merchandise is visually appealing, well-stocked, and presented according to store guidelines to attract customers and maximize sales. They may also be responsible for cleaning display areas, setting up promotional displays, and rotating stock as needed. These positions typically require attention to detail, creativity, and the ability to work independently or as part of a team. Evening shifts are common to prepare the store for the next business day or accommodate stores with extended hours.

What does a display merchandiser do?

A display merchandiser is responsible for creating attractive product displays in retail stores to attract customers and increase sales. They plan and set up visual layouts, arrange merchandise, and ensure displays are clean and well-stocked, often using tools like signage and props. The role requires attention to detail, creativity, and knowledge of retail standards and safety procedures.

What is the 80 20 rule in merchandising?

In merchandising, the 80/20 rule suggests that approximately 80% of sales come from 20% of products. For an evening merchandise display role, focusing on high-performing items can maximize sales and improve display effectiveness.

Retail Store Evening Merchandiser (Full-Time) - Butte, MT

Harrington Bottling Company (HC) - A Proud Pepsi Bottler Pay: $17.00/hour DOE | Schedule: Wednesday-Sunday, 11:00 AM - 7:30 PM Union Position: IAM (International Association of Machinists and Aerospace Workers)

Harrington Bottling Company is hiring a reliable and motivated Retail Store Evening Merchandiser to join our team in Butte, Montana. This full-time role is ideal for someone who enjoys a fast-paced environment, working independently, and interacting with customers while supporting well-known beverage brands.

As a retail merchandiser and stocker, you will be responsible for servicing an established route and ensuring products are properly stocked, rotated, and displayed in retail locations. Daily responsibilities include stocking shelves, coolers, racks, and displays; organizing and maintaining back stock; and building effective product displays to support sales. You will also maintain strong relationships with store personnel, provide excellent customer service, and communicate opportunities for increased sales to the sales team. Routes may include local and occasional out-of-town travel depending on customer needs.

This role is physically active and requires frequent lifting, carrying, bending, kneeling, and moving products using carts or hand trucks throughout the workday. It is well-suited for individuals who prefer staying active and engaged during their shift.

Qualified candidates must be at least 18 years old and have a valid driver's license, reliable vehicle, and current auto insurance. Strong communication skills, attention to detail, and a consistent, dependable work ethic are essential to success in this role. Previous experience in retail merchandising, grocery stocking, beverage distribution, route sales, or customer service is preferred but not required.
